Job Description

About the Role:

The Company is actively seeking a Mechanical Project Manager with 12 years of experience in mechanical engineering design and project management. If youre a Licensed Professional Engineer (PE) with a passion for innovative HVAC and plumbing systems in the education public works water/wastewater transportation government aviation or transit sectors this is your opportunity to lead impactful projects from concept to completion.

This is a leadership role with a focus on project delivery mechanical system design team coordination and client interaction.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Lead mechanical design projects from planning through construction

  • Manage all aspects of project delivery: scope schedule budget and quality
  • Oversee HVAC load calculations energy modeling and field investigations
  • Prepare and review mechanical/plumbing design documents (drawings specs)
  • Supervise and mentor junior engineers and design staff

  • Ensure compliance with all local state and national codes

  • Coordinate with clients architects contractors and code officials

  • Support marketing proposals and business development efforts

  • Lead multidisciplinary teams and manage internal and external resources
  • Provide leadership and mentorship to engineering team members

Required Qualifications:

  • Bachelors Degree in Mechanical or Architectural Engineering (ABET Accredited)
  • 12 years of mechanical design and project management experience

  • Professional Engineer (PE) License (required)

  • Expertise in HVAC and plumbing system design

  • Proficient in Revit AutoCAD and load calculation tools (Carrier HAP IESVE preferred)
  • Strong understanding of building mechanical energy and plumbing codes
  • Proficient with Microsoft Office Suite

  • Valid drivers license and ability to pass company motor vehicle screening

Preferred Qualifications (Nice to Have):

  • Project Management Certifications: CAPM PMP

  • Commissioning certifications: CxA BCxP

  • Experience in Design-Build Design-Bid-Build and P3 project delivery

  • Experience managing multidisciplinary teams and complex infrastructure projects
  • Knowledge of fire protection and industrial mechanical systems

  • Background working with federal state and local agencies
